This fund primarily invests at least 80% of its net assets, including any borrowed capital, in the equity securities of international companies. These "small companies" are defined as those non-U.S. based entities with total operating revenues of $500 million or less at the time of initial purchase. The Advisor typically ensures that cash constitutes no more than 5% of the portfolio. It is the Advisor's belief that a diversified portfolio comprising 40 to 65 securities, coupled with diligent research, can collectively help reduce investment risk.
